Cezar Bonifacio changes the numbers on a gas price display at a Chevron gasoline station May 19, 2008 in San Francisco, California. For the thirteenth straight day, U.S. gas prices have reached another record high when the national average price of regular gasoline rose to $3.79 a gallon, up 30 cents from last month's average.
